Hamamatsu Photonics K.K. (TYO:6965)
Japan flag Japan · Delayed Price · Currency is JPY
1,503.00
-21.00 (-1.38%)
Nov 21, 2025, 3:30 PM JST

Hamamatsu Photonics K.K. Ratios and Metrics

Millions JPY.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Nov '25 Sep '25 Sep '24 Sep '23 Sep '22 Sep '21 2016 - 2020
449,038479,512581,922975,410959,9981,074,504
Upgrade
Market Cap Growth
-28.36%-17.60%-40.34%1.60%-10.66%31.20%
Upgrade
Enterprise Value
419,962441,372514,410867,672852,713992,404
Upgrade
Last Close Price
1503.001605.001831.103020.582939.363253.23
Upgrade
PE Ratio
31.7633.7623.1422.7823.2542.89
Upgrade
Forward PE
26.1427.3020.6323.4624.3843.21
Upgrade
PS Ratio
2.122.262.854.414.606.36
Upgrade
PB Ratio
1.391.481.753.053.414.52
Upgrade
P/TBV Ratio
1.561.671.973.113.494.64
Upgrade
P/FCF Ratio
238.98255.2059.30207.4534.2748.62
Upgrade
P/OCF Ratio
11.8812.6915.2928.4821.2726.92
Upgrade
PEG Ratio
8.711.651.651.651.651.65
Upgrade
EV/Sales Ratio
1.982.082.523.924.085.87
Upgrade
EV/EBITDA Ratio
10.8711.4610.3112.1912.1020.73
Upgrade
EV/EBIT Ratio
25.8227.3016.0215.3114.9628.92
Upgrade
EV/FCF Ratio
223.50234.9052.42184.5330.4444.91
Upgrade
Debt / Equity Ratio
0.200.200.110.040.040.04
Upgrade
Debt / EBITDA Ratio
1.711.710.740.180.160.20
Upgrade
Debt / FCF Ratio
35.1635.163.762.660.410.44
Upgrade
Asset Turnover
0.480.480.490.580.630.59
Upgrade
Inventory Turnover
1.411.411.281.511.861.95
Upgrade
Quick Ratio
1.321.321.802.512.562.72
Upgrade
Current Ratio
2.182.182.963.813.543.67
Upgrade
Return on Equity (ROE)
4.44%4.44%7.78%14.30%15.97%11.18%
Upgrade
Return on Assets (ROA)
2.27%2.27%4.79%9.21%10.67%7.48%
Upgrade
Return on Capital (ROIC)
2.66%2.66%5.71%11.32%13.17%9.15%
Upgrade
Return on Capital Employed (ROCE)
4.70%4.70%9.10%16.90%19.20%13.80%
Upgrade
Earnings Yield
3.16%2.96%4.32%4.39%4.30%2.33%
Upgrade
FCF Yield
0.42%0.39%1.69%0.48%2.92%2.06%
Upgrade
Dividend Yield
2.53%2.37%2.08%1.26%1.23%0.74%
Upgrade
Payout Ratio
81.43%81.43%46.91%28.21%22.53%24.76%
Upgrade
Buyback Yield / Dilution
3.09%3.09%-0.01%-0.01%-0.01%-0.01%
Upgrade
Total Shareholder Return
5.58%5.45%2.06%1.25%1.22%0.73%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.